Description

    Technical Field of the Invention
  • The present invention is related to a rifle adapter bracket mechanism that has been developed to overcome the problems such as the need to use different brackets which have been developed for the present rifles of MG3, A4, A6 and BİXİ, the need to configure a separate rifle for each rifle bracket, and to avoid the problems (not having extra rifle brackets, for the rifle bracket changes to be difficult and takes long time etc) created in connection with a single rifle bracket being present on a vehicle when a different rifle needs to be used and to ensure the efficient usage of different types of rifles by using a single rifle adapter bracket for all types of rifles.
  • State of the Art (Prior Art)
  • Different types of rifle usage are needed according to their defence types in vehicles having different rifles, used for defence purposes, mounted on top. The usage of different rifle types is directly related with rifle brackets. Due to this reason, for many years studies have been carried out to enable the usage of the said brackets for different types of rifles.
  • Nowadays, rifle rigs located on vehicles are fixed onto the vehicle by means of a bracket. Said rifle bracket enables the usage of the rifle after it is fixed to the vehicle. Each rifle has its distinctive bracket. And each different rifle has different coupling means that allow the rifle to be coupled to the bracket. The rifle bracket varieties that are present commercially do not have the design characteristics that can fulfil the expectations of customers. Moreover, in the case that a different type of rifle is desired to be used for defence during any kind of operation in defence vehicles, the rifle bracket that is being used at that moment also needs to be changed.
  • Furthermore it is both more expensive to keep different types of brackets for different types of rifles within the vehicle and also as they will consume space inside the vehicle, it is desirable to have a bracket designed such that it can be commonly used for different types of rifles. The aim in doing so, is to overcome the negative conditions that may arise such as ergonomic problems, and increase in costs and space consumption. Due to this a single type of rifle bracket has been obtained as desired by the customers by means of an adapter bracket mechanism that is to be mounted on the rifle bracket, thereby allowing the usage of different types of rifles with the same bracket in a vehicle.
  • In the inventions subject to the applications numbered GB 2493363 A2 and US 20120180643 A1 within the known state of the art, mechanisms relating to adjustable rifle brackets that can be mounted on vehicles have been described. In these inventions, the rifle is fixed onto the vehicle. And said inventions are related to enabling the lateral movement of the rifle fixed onto the vehicles and for the user to be able to carry out operations at different angles. The mechanisms that are being described above, are not mechanisms that allow different types of rifles to be used in a single bracket. According to these applications the rifle brackets are produced to hold a single type of rifle, whereas nowadays this type of bracket is unsatisfactory as it cannot be used with multiple rifles during defence operations. The invention described in detail below is related to a single bracket which enables the fixing of different types of rifles on vehicles, by means of an additional adapter bracket mechanism. US2870683 , which forms a basis for the claim, discloses a rifle adaptor bracket mechanism for mounting a rifle on a vehicle comprising a fixing leg, a coupling leg that can rotate 360° in a horizontal plane relative to the fixing leg, a first bracket rotatably mounted on the coupling leg so that the first bracket can rotate in a vertical plane relative to the coupling leg, an adjustable rifle bracket mounted on the first bracket for supporting and holding a rifle, a dismantling latch, a fixing pin, an adjustable mobile pin, said fixed pin and said mobike pin cooperating to mount rifles of different widths. This document does not disclose a fixing leg fixed to a vehicle and a mechanism that includes adjustable cabin impact protector. Present invention allows assembly and disassembly of the adjustable rifle bracket relative to the first bracket and height adjusting mechanism enables fixating of a rifle in the adjustable rifle bracket.

    Detailed Description of the Invention
  • The invention subject to the application provides the usage of a single fixed bracket for different rifles to be used during operational applications used for defence purposes by means of attaching an additional adapter bracket mechanism.
  • Nowadays as the rifle brackets on the vehicles is different for each different rifle, and as different types of rifles cannot be used when desired with a single bracket and the obligation to keep different rifle brackets in order to use different rifles this situation is costly and also not practical. These problems are avoided by means of the present invention.
  • The front face and the rear face views of the adapter bracket that has been designed as a new design and described with the present invention have been shown in Figure 1 and figure 2. The coupling leg (2) that is attached onto the vehicle fixing leg (1) in this invention has been designed such that it can rotate 360° in order to provide defence against attacks from different directions. The cabin impact protector (5) that has been attached to the coupling leg (2)has been designed with a corresponding part in order to overcome the risk of lowering down of the barrel of the rifle in an uncontrolled manner and in return the danger of an impact to the cabin. Due to the adjusted structure of the cabin impact protector, the rifle brackets can be mounted into vehicles safely. MG3 rifle bracket (3) has been mounted on the coupling leg (2). The characteristic of the MG3 rifle bracket herein, is that it has both been produced in order to couple the MG3 rifle and that it can act as the main bracket for the adjustable rifle bracket (4) In order to make the disassembly easier following the mounting of the adjustable rifle bracket (4) to the MG3 rifle bracket (2) a special bracket and a rifle disassembly latch (6) has been used. The adjustable rifle bracket (4) has been designed in order to allow the mounting of rifles having different sizes. A fixed pin (7) is found on the adjustable rifle bracket (4), that allows the mounting of different rifles having different coupling diameters. The fixed pin (7) and the mobile pin (8) which is concentric with the fixed pin, has been designed to be adjusted when mounting rifles with different widths. The adjustable mobile pin (8) is locked after the adjusting procedure is carried out. The height of the rifle is adjusted by means of an adjustable fixing plate (9) that enables the fixing and the elevation of the rifle after the rifle has been coupled to the bracket.
  • By means of the invention, the usage of a single rifle bracket has been provided for mounting rifles with different coupling diameters, different widths and heights in order to mount said rifles without any problems onto different vehicles.

Claims (1)

  1. A rifle adapter bracket mechanism mountable on a vehicle having a cabin, characterized in that it comprises;
    • A fixing leg (1) fixable to the vehicle,
    • Coupling leg (2), on the fixing leg (1) that can rotate 360° in a horizontal plane,
    • Adjustable cabin impact protector (5) is a rotational-movement limiting stop to overcome the risk of lowering down of the barrel of the rifle in an uncontrolled manner and the danger of an impact to the cabin that can be mounted onto the coupling leg (2),
    • rifle bracket (3) mounted rotatable in a vertical plane on the coupling leg of the rifle bracket mechanism,
    • Adjustable rifle bracket (4) mounted on the rifle bracket (3) acting as the main bracket,
    • A bracket and rifle dismantling latch (6) used for easy assembly and disassembly of the adjustable rifle bracket (4) onto the rifle bracket (3),
    • A fixing pin (7) used, to mount rifles having different coupling diameters onto adjustable rifle brackets (4),
    • Adjustable mobile pin (8), concentric with the fixed pin (7) used, to mount rifles having different diameters,
    and
    • Height adjustable fixing plate (9) that enables the fixing of a rifle.
